  • "There is no hierarchy of oppressions." ~ Audre Lorde Or is there? When it comes to gender, prominent feminists say that gender oppression is the primary discrimination that trumps all others. And that once this is resolved, everything else will align. However, historians protest that America is built on racism and it is embedded in everything that we live. Until racism is given its proper attention, we are doomed. And then there's the intersectionality of it all!  On Thursday, March 4th at 9:00 pm EST Funmilayo Ekundayo, mother and aspiring travel journalist, debated her premise that Gender oppression is more of a significant challenge than Racial oppression in the United States of America, against activist and revolutionary, Cameron Montgomery.
